The Role of Gratitude in Shifting Consciousness

 Gratitude is often discussed as a "politeness" or a social grace, but in the realm of psychology and spirituality, it is a powerful tool for shifting one's entire perception of reality. You cannot be in a state of fear and a state of genuine gratitude at the same time. One naturally displaces the other.

Focusing on What is "Right" The human brain has a natural "negative bias," meaning we are wired to look for threats and problems. Gratitude is the intentional practice of over-riding this bias. It’s about training the mind to notice the thousands of things that are going right every day—from the air we breathe to the technology that connects us. The Ripple Effect of Appreciation When you live in a state of gratitude, you become more pleasant to be around. Your relationships improve, your work becomes more effortless, and your overall outlook becomes more optimistic. Gratitude isn't about ignoring the challenges of life; it’s about having a foundation of abundance that allows you to handle those challenges with grace. It is the simplest and most effective "life hack" for a happy existence.
